OLED Panel Aging and Display Artifact Formation

An aging OLED panel gradually suffers pixel degradation as its organic compounds wear unevenly. The resulting display artifact, color distortion, or other visual defect can leave persistent vertical lines on phone screen. Brightness and dead-pixel tests help confirm screen aging.

Backlight Failure Creating Discoloration Stripes

Backlight clue: An LCD backlight module with an LED driver fault can create a discoloration stripe or brightness inconsistency.

Panel clue: A damaged diffuser sheet changes screen lighting, so this illumination fault may resemble phone screen lines without being a true pixel failure.

Heat Separator Method to Reseat Ribbon Cable

A heat separator at a repair station gives steady temperature control, softening the adhesive without blasting the phone with uncontrolled heat.

  • Access the display carefully:

    • Warm it evenly; avoid batteries and cameras.

    • Lift the panel without sharply bending the flex cable.

  • Check the connection:

    • Disconnect power before touching the ribbon cable.

    • Inspect and reseat it, then test for vertical lines on phone screen.

Precision Screwdriver Adjustment of Display Assembly

A precision screwdriver makes work around the display assembly far less fiddly. Keep each internal bracket, fasteners, and screws organized by original location.

  1. Power off the phone and open it using the model-specific procedure.

  2. Inspect connections where the screen meets the phone chassis.

  3. Refit shields and use manufacturer-specified torque. Mixing screw lengths can puncture or crush parts.

Anti-Static Mat and Spudger Tool for Digitizer Swapping

When a faulty digitizer accompanies screen lines or touch problems, static control matters.

  • Protect the device:

    • Work on an anti-static mat.

    • Wear an ESD strap correctly grounded.

  • Swap carefully:

    • Use a nonconductive spudger tool to release each connector, not metal tools.

    • Fit the replacement touch screen without forcing delicate phone components.

  • Test before sealing:

    • Check taps, swipes, brightness, and screen lines.

    • If vertical lines on phone screen remain, the display panel or board may require professional diagnosis.

How a Loose Connector Triggers Screen Flickering

A partly seated display connector can break electrical contact for a split second, causing screen flickering or vertical lines on phone screen.

  • Connection changes

    • A loose ribbon cable may shift when the phone bends or gets warm.

    • Small voltage fluctuation can distort pixels.

      • If vertical lines on phone screen change after gentle movement, hardware looseness becomes a stronger suspect.

      • Persistent lines still require panel testing.

Diagnosing Signal Interference in the Ribbon Cable

Finding the cause takes more than eyeballing the screen. A technician can trace signal interference through the ribbon cable while checking how reliably image data moves.

  1. Inspect the connector.

    • Look for dirty pins, corrosion, or torn traces affecting data transmission.

    • Check for nearby electromagnetic noise.

  2. Test the path.

    • A diagnostic tool can identify unstable signals or oscillation.

    • A circuit continuity test checks for broken electrical paths.

This process helps separate cable-related phone lines from OLED or controller faults without guesswork.

Repair Vertical Line Screens

Repair can save a perfectly usable display when vertical lines on phone screen come from a connection or recoverable component rather than broken panel layers.

  1. Start with simple checks:

    • Restart device and watch for disappearing vertical screen lines.

    • Rule out a software glitch; use a factory reset only after backing up data.

  2. Inspect the hardware:

    • Run a diagnostic test on the ribbon cable connection.

    • Reseat a loose connector or replace a damaged connector where practical.

  3. Confirm the result:

    • Treat pressure tricks as a temporary fix, not a proper repair.
